Subject: Cut-over summary — Lanthorn address autocomplete

For the security review: we completed the cut-over of the Lanthorn autocomplete widget to the new suggestion backend last night. All lookups now stay within our network boundary; the old third-party path is disabled, not just deprecated. Input sanitization moved server-side, and rate limiting is enforced per session. Rollback window closes Thursday. The production configuration now in effect is listed below.

settings of fafog-haduf:
ZORIX_PIN=4648
ZORIX_METRICS_HOST=metrics.zorix.paliqsys.corp
ZORIX_LOG_LEVEL=info
ZORIX_TENANT=druix

Subject: Handover — TraceWeave release duties

Hi, taking over from me this sprint for TraceWeave, our cross-service request tracer at Quillford Systems. The collector and span-forwarder ship together; review both changelogs before tagging. Sampling config changes need sign-off from the platform group, and the propagation headers are frozen until v3. CI signs artifacts automatically, but the manual hotfix path requires you to sign locally. The key you'll need for that is:

deploy key for kajof-fajop: bky6_gDHw9Q

## Import rework for Shelfwright catalogue loader

Replaces the row-by-row MARC ingest with chunked batches. Duplicate detection now keys on normalized title plus accession year, which cut false merges in the Dunmore Library test set from 4% to near zero. Retry logic backs off exponentially; failed chunks land in the quarantine table for manual review. No schema changes. Maintainers: if import throughput drops, check the chunk sizing first. Current tuning constants are as follows.

tuning table, tafog-bahap:
QUOTAS = {
    "holix": 5,
    "quenath": 2,
    "wenwyn": 1,
    "quenwyn": 2,
}

### Onboarding: Queue Migration Context

We are replacing the homegrown Taskwheel job queue with Relaymesh. Taskwheel lacked retry semantics and visibility timeouts, causing duplicate processing under load. Migration proceeds service by service; dual-writes run for two weeks each. Relaymesh workers pull only signed job bundles, so every engineer must register the signing key below.

rollout seal: bky4_DFM9